About the Business Unit
Corrections Victoria is responsible for the direction, management and operation of Victoria's prison system and Post Sentence Scheme. As a service agency within the Department of Justice &
Community Safety (DJCS), Corrections Victoria develops and implements policies, programs and services that ensure the safe and secure containment of prisoners, and that seek to rehabilitate offenders by addressing the underlying causes of offending behaviour.
About the Role
The HR Supervisor provides a responsive and proactive service on a range of operational and strategic human resources related matters including employment conditions, recruitment and retention of staff, workforce planning, performance management, learning and development, employee relations, dispute resolution, equity and diversity, occupational health and safety and workers compensation.
The HR Supervisor is also responsible for undertaking a range of responsibilities across a broad range of human resources functions, operating across a number of those functions. In this role, you will foster the desired organisational culture by modelling agreed values and behaviours and contribute to the achievement of the respective Corporate Plan, Business Plan and Workforce Strategy priorities through coordinating the right people in the right roles working with the right systems and processes and engaging and collaborating with external and internal stakeholders.
**Some of your duties will include**:

- Provide consultancy advice, guidance and solutions to management and staff on a broad range of human resource issues including policies, frameworks, processes, employment conditions, performance management, OH&S, recruitment, learning and development, workforce planning, and HR legislation, seeking support from local HR BP where required.
- Manage a small team of staff who provide HR administration support.
- Establish and maintain effective relationships with key stakeholders to create mutually beneficial partnerships.
